03/09/2026 Industrial Placement Chemical Engineering Students Milton Hill, Oxfordshire | £24,785 per annum Kick- start your career with a placement at Infineum, a world leading formulator, manufacturer and marketer of additives for fuels and lubricants. Infineum additives are in 1 in 3 vehicles worldwide , and are designed to improve fuel efficiency, reduce emissions and enable cleaner transportations . This 12-month placement offers Chemical Engineering undergraduates the opportunity to work in our Manufacturing Technology team or Technology Applications and Services team based at our Global Headquarters at Milton Hill in Oxfordshire. You will work in multi-functional teams on projects in areas such as: Process development and scale-up Plant troubleshooting and support Process improvement to reduce cost and waste, increase capacity or improve product quality Safety management systems You will gain valuable knowledge and expertise in: The challenges associated with translating processes from the lab through to commercial production Understanding and addressing the challenges in real live plant issues Reactive chemistry and process engineering Working in a best practice global organisation; working with different functions, across time zones, distance and cultures, problem solving and decision making Placements begin in July 2027.
